Course Details

Fundamentals of 3D Printing: Understanding the Basics | Additive Manufacturing Technologies | 3D Printing Materials
3D Modeling for 3D Printing: Introduction to CAD Software | 3D Model Preparation | Optimizing Designs for 3D Printing
3D Printing Technologies: Fused Deposition Modeling (FDM) | Stereolithography (SLA) | Selective Laser Sintering (SLS)
Lighting Technology Fundamentals: Color Theory | Lighting Design Principles | Types of Lighting
3D Printing in Lighting Design: Custom Luminaires | 3D Printed Light Diffusers | Smart Lighting Solutions
Lighting Control Systems and Connectivity: Wired and Wireless Solutions | IoT-enabled Lighting Systems | Home Automation
Sustainability in 3D Printing and Lighting: Energy-efficient Lighting Technologies | Eco-friendly 3D Printing Materials
Prototyping and Production with 3D Printing and Lighting: Rapid Prototyping | Small-scale Manufacturing | Scaling Up for Mass Production
Applications of 3D Printing and Lighting Technology: Architectural Lighting | Entertainment Lighting | Retail and Exhibition Spaces
Emerging Trends and Future Developments: Advancements in 3D Printing Technologies | Integration of AI and ML in Lighting Design
